YOUR ROLE
Our Automation Assurance Specialists ensure the reliability and quality of technical solutions delivered to clients, providing confidence that implementations meet expectations and specifications.
Responsibilities include executing comprehensive testing across Accessibility, Performance, Security, and Functional validation, designing and maintaining clean, robust automation test suites, integrating them into a continuous integration pipeline, and collaborating across engineering teams.
